Sacked Ukraine defence minister urges path to elections

Ukraine’s ousted defence minister Mykhailo Fedorov has called for elections to be held despite the ongoing war with Russia, stating the country is facing a crisis of governance. His address was posted on YouTube. Ukrainian law currently prohibits elections while martial law, imposed on 24 February 2022 following the Russian invasion, remains in effect. Fedorov argued that while holding elections during wartime is complex, it is not impossible.

Background

Why this event matters

Former Ukrainian Defence Minister Mykhailo Fedorov, who was dismissed from his post last month, has publicly called for a transition towards holding elections in Ukraine. Fedorov argued that democracy should not be held hostage by Russia and urged the establishment of a legal mechanism to restore democratic processes. This appeal challenges President Volodymyr Zelensky’s continued leadership during the ongoing conflict. Voting has been suspended since the Russian invasion began in February 2022, when martial law was imposed, as military rule currently prohibits the holding of elections.
